Output 3eae751c65fa12947645bae29c791508b2f04fea8caeba88c02ccbcfffd96074:5

value
108676
script pubkey
OP_0 OP_PUSHBYTES_20 671b4d80814c51f53c416709e31d35dcbe26e442
address
bc1qvud5mqypf3gl20zpvuy7x8f4mjlzdezzjkxnw4
transaction
3eae751c65fa12947645bae29c791508b2f04fea8caeba88c02ccbcfffd96074
spent
true